What can I use as a base for a fairy garden?
Fairy Garden Ingredients
- Potting mix.
- A container with drainage holes.
- Plants, twigs, and/or flowers.
- Pea gravel, pebbles, glass marbles.
- Mini garden decorations such as a fairy house, mini table and chairs, and a fence.
What do you do with a fairy garden in the winter?
Perennials, miniature trees and shrubs are not houseplants; they need a cold, dormant period in the winter. You can bring the container into an unheated garage, or porch, ideally somewhere about 32 to 50 degrees. The goal is to maintain dormancy without subjecting the plants to repeated freezing and thawing.
